Italy - Pork Export Volume
Since 2014, Italy Pork Export Volume jumped by 3.2%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 11 comparing other countries in Pork Export Volume at 333 Thousand Metric Tons. Italy is overtaken by France, which was ranked number 10 with 537 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Ireland with 292 Thousand Metric Tons. United States ranked the highest with 2,630 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, that is a fall of 0.3% versus 2018. Germany, Spain and Denmark resp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Argentina witnessed the best average annual growth at +55.2% per year, while Lebanon was the worst growing country at -100% per year.
